Less than a week after it was announced that Frida Giannini would be leaving her post as Gucci creative director, rumors are already swirling about who could be her replacement. Although many sources seem to point to Riccardo Tisci or Joseph Alutzarra as contenders, Page Six is reporting that Hedi Slimane could be in the running as well. Slimane has been doing well at Saint Laurent for the past two years with the French fashion house posting an increase in profits of 28% in October. What do you think?
